L. Sheldon Daly '58
- Established in 1991, the William J. Donlon Special
Achievement Award is given to those individuals who, in the
judgment of the Varsity Club Hall of Fame Selection
Committee, have demonstrated uncommon dedication and
performed supererogatory service to Boston College
athletics, both on and off the fields of play. The award is
named in honor of Reverend William J. Donlon '31, in
recognition of more than sixty years participation, service,
and devotion.
- Few individuals have contributed as much time and
talent to the Boston College Varsity Club as L. Sheldon
Daly, Jr.
- A long-time member of the Varsity Club, he served as
Club Treasurer for 10 years (1986-1995). During that
time he organized and directed the Club's Hall
of Fame Banquets with unequaled success and helped
establish the "Wall of Fame" - featuring
all inductees' plaques - along the west corridor
of the Silvio O. Conte Forum.
- Daly also was instrumental in forming the "Hall
of Fame Club" - a popular home game social
venu during the Boston College football season.
Proceeds from the Hall of Fame Club have benefited
Boston College's Olympic Sports teams and
Sports Medicine services.
